Meeting Notes Format Template

Meeting notes format templates are essential for capturing the core discussions, decisions, and action items from any meeting. They’re more than just a list; they’re a structured record that facilitates clear communication, accountability, and future reference. Whether you’re a project manager, team lead, or executive, having a standardized template ensures everyone is on the same page and can quickly access the vital information. This guide will explore the best practices for creating effective meeting notes, demonstrating how to structure your notes to maximize their value. Meeting Notes Format Template is a critical tool for streamlining communication and ensuring project success. A well-crafted template can significantly reduce misunderstandings and improve overall team efficiency. Let’s dive into how to build one that works for you.

Before we delve into specific templates, it’s crucial to understand why structured meeting notes are so valuable. Traditional, unstructured notes often lead to information overload, missed details, and confusion. A structured format forces you to prioritize, condense, and clearly articulate key information. This template is ideal for visualizing the flow of a meeting and identifying key decision points.

Image 6 for Meeting Notes Format Template

(Start)
* Agenda: [Briefly state the agenda]
* Discussion:
* [Topic 1] – [Brief Description]
* [Topic 2] – [Brief Description]
* [Topic 3] – [Brief Description]

Image 7 for Meeting Notes Format Template

(Decision Point 1)
* Decision: [Clearly state the decision]
* Rationale: [Explain the reasoning behind the decision]

Image 8 for Meeting Notes Format Template

(Action Item 1)
* Action: [Action to be taken]
* Owner: [Person responsible]
* Due Date: [Date]

Image 9 for Meeting Notes Format Template

(Action Item 2)
* Action: [Action to be taken]
* Owner: [Person responsible]
* Due Date: [Date]

(Decision Point 2)
* Decision: [Clearly state the decision]
* Rationale: [Explain the reasoning behind the decision]

(Next Steps) [Outline any follow-up actions]
